Subject: Re: [PATCH v4 07/18] mm: x86: Untag addresses in EXECMEM_ROX related
 pointer arithmetic

On 2025-08-14 at 10:26:19 +0300, Mike Rapoport wrote:
>On Tue, Aug 12, 2025 at 03:23:43PM +0200, Maciej Wieczor-Retman wrote:
>> ARCH_HAS_EXECMEM_ROX was re-enabled in x86 at Linux 6.14 release.
>> Related code has multiple spots where page virtual addresses end up used
>> as arguments in arithmetic operations. Combined with enabled tag-based
>> KASAN it can result in pointers that don't point where they should or
>> logical operations not giving expected results.
>> 
>> vm_reset_perms() calculates range's start and end addresses using min()
>> and max() functions. To do that it compares pointers but some are not
>> tagged - addr variable is, start and end variables aren't.
>> 
>> within() and within_range() can receive tagged addresses which get
>> compared to untagged start and end variables.
>> 
>> Reset tags in addresses used as function arguments in min(), max(),
>> within() and within_range().
>> 
>> execmem_cache_add() adds tagged pointers to a maple tree structure,
>> which then are incorrectly compared when walking the tree. That results
>> in different pointers being returned later and page permission violation
>> errors panicking the kernel.
>> 
>> Reset tag of the address range inserted into the maple tree inside
>> execmem_cache_add().
>>

>AFAIU, we use plain address without the tag as an index in
>execmem_cache_add(), so here mas->index will be a plain address as well

I'll recheck to make sure but I had some unspecific errors such as "page
permission violation". So I thought a page address must be picked incorrectly
somewhere due to tagging. After revising most places where there is pointer
arithmetic / comparisons and printing these addresses I found some were tagged
in within_range().

But I'll recheck if my other changes didn't make this line redundant. I added
this first which fixed some issues but then I found more which were fixed by
resetting addr in execmem_cache_add_locked().
